On our vacation, we'll be leaving Oakland on the 27th and meeting with a friend in Grants Pass on the 28th.
The 27th ALSO happens to be my son's 6th birthday. So... looking for someplace to camp, relatively close to I-5, between Oakland and Grants Pass, and something fun to do in the area for the 6yo on his birthday.  SUGGESTIONS??

We have camped in Whiskeytown a number of times. It is about 30 min west of Redding. They have numerous lakes, the water is cold but really clear and nice.  It never seems to get really crowded. You have to pick a campsite at the visitors center/ranger station.  :)  enjoy!

I'll second camping at Whiskeytown.  It's a pretty lake with swimming.  If you go into Redding, the Turtle Bay Museum and Paul Bunyan Forest Camp might also be fun for a 6 year old (http://www.turtlebay.org/).
